Output 50eb4e0a52751c66c6d4017eea91d0714af2d8c81b783487d8de509e3ada0343:54

value
349747
script pubkey
OP_0 OP_PUSHBYTES_20 3ccdb0b20e99d5cd7fe8c77703575c59259bad44
address
bc1q8nxmpvswn82u6llgcamsx46utyjeht2ysq22ql
transaction
50eb4e0a52751c66c6d4017eea91d0714af2d8c81b783487d8de509e3ada0343